CARP 1124

Exterior Enviro Design Methods

Credits: 3

Description: This course will enable the learner to develop skills used to properly install windows, exterior doors, sofits, house wraps, and various siding brands and styles. This course will emphasis greed building and its proper materials. Prerequisite(s): None

Credit Breakdown: 1/2/0 (Lecture/Lab/On the job training)

Competencies

  1. Install various types of windows in an approved manner.
  2. Apply house wrap to project house.
  3. Demonstrate basic jobsite safety.
  4. Fit and hang an exterior door with hardware.
  5. Apply various types of siding materials.
  6. Install aluminum soffit and fascia.
  7. Air seal any penetrations in the exterior walls.
  8. Apply caulking where needed.
  9. Discuss what the green products would be used in exterior finish.
